A 2-in.-diameter straight round shaft is subjected to a bending of 2000 ft lb.
(a) What is the nominal bending stress at the surface?
(b) If a hollow shaft of inside diameter 0.5 times outside diameter is used, what outside diameter would be required to give the same outer surface stress?
